title | Crystal Structure Of The Complex Of Human Atg101-Atg13 Horma | ||||||||||||||
authors | S.Qi, J.H.Hurley | ||||||||||||||
compound | source | ||||||||||||||
Molecule: Autophagy-Related Protein 101 Chain: A Fragment: Unp Residues 1-198 Engineered: Yes |
Organism_scientific: Homo Sapiens Organism_common: Human Organism_taxid: 9606 Gene: Atg101, C12orf44, Pp894 Expression_system: Spodoptera Frugiperda Expression_system_common: Fall Armyworm Expression_system_taxid: 7108 Expression_system_vector_type: Baculovirus | ||||||||||||||
Molecule: Autophagy-Related Protein 13 Chain: B Fragment: Unp Residues 12-200 Engineered: Yes Other_details: Gamgs Is From Vector |
Organism_scientific: Homo Sapiens Organism_common: Human Organism_taxid: 9606 Gene: Atg13, Kiaa0652 Expression_system: Spodoptera Frugiperda Expression_system_common: Fall Armyworm Expression_system_taxid: 7108 Expression_system_vector_type: Baculovirus | ||||||||||||||
symmetry | Space Group: C 1 2 1 |
| |||||||||||||
crystal cell |
| ||||||||||||||
method | X-Ray Diffraction | resolution | 1.63 Å | ||||||||||||
ligand | BEN | enzyme |
| ||||||||||||
Gene Ontology |
| ||||||||||||||
Primary reference | Structure of the Human Atg13-Atg101 HORMA Heterodimer: an Interaction Hub within the ULK1 Complex., Qi S, Kim do J, Stjepanovic G, Hurley JH, Structure. 2015 Oct 6;23(10):1848-57. doi: 10.1016/j.str.2015.07.011. Epub 2015, Aug 20. PMID:26299944 |
